The global organic flocculant market is expected to grow at a CAGR of 5.5% during the forecast period, to reach USD 1.2 billion by 2030. The growth of this market can be attributed to the increasing demand for organic flocculants in water treatment and oil & gas applications, owing to their ability to remove suspended solids from water and oil respectively. The technical grade segment is expected to account for the largest share of the global organic flocculant market in terms of revenue, followed by industriagrade and paper grade segments respectively. The industrial grade segment is projected to grow at a CAGR of 6% during the forecast period, owing primarily due its wide application across various industries such as water treatment, oil & gas extraction and minerals extraction among others.
